Job Title: Delivery Manager  

Location: Chiswick  

 

About the role  

 

The Delivery Manager within BSI’s Knowledge Solutions department plays a critical role in ensuring the seamless execution of projects, products, and services that support our mission of driving excellence and innovation.  

 

This role is responsible for orchestrating cross-functional teams, managing stakeholder expectations, and ensuring timely, high-quality, and cost-effective delivery. The Delivery Manager ensures that delivery objectives align with business goals, meet client expectations, and contribute to the organization's overall success. 

 

Responsibilities:  

 

Oversee the successful delivery of projects, ensuring they meet objectives, deadlines, and quality standards. 

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, teams, and stakeholders to align expectations. 

Lead and support cross-functional teams, including developers, designers, and testers. 

Identify and resolve delivery risks to ensure success. 

Improve processes to boost efficiency, quality, and team performance. 

Share regular updates and progress reports with stakeholders and senior management. 

To be successful in the role, you will have:  

Strong understanding of project management methodologies (e.g., Agile, Waterfall, or hybrid approaches) with practical application experience. 

Experience managing cross-functional teams  

Professional certifications such as PMP, PRINCE2, Agile Scrum Master, or equivalent. 

Ability to analyze and interpret complex data for informed decision-making.

Headquartered in London, BSI is the world's first national standards organization with more than 100 years of experience. We are a global partner for 86,000 companies and organizations in over 193 countries, offering development, auditing, certification, and training services, including innovative software solutions and cyber security expertise for all industries: from aerospace and automotive to food, construction, energy, healthcare, IT and trade sectors. Incorporated by Royal Charter, we’re truly impartial, and home to the ultimate mark of trust, the Kitemark.
